WebJul 2, 2024 · A body corporate is a legal entity automatically created when a developer subdivides a plot of land and registers it with Land Information New Zealand as a unit title development. Most townhouses and apartments are unit titles governed by a body corporate. A corporation consisting of a body of persons legally authorized to act as one person, while being distinct from that person. For example, the shareholders of a company are separate from the company.
